    Background

    Background: Enables signaling receptor binding activity and trans-2-enoyl-CoA reductase (NADPH) activity. Involved in phytol metabolic process. Located in peroxisome.

    Gene Full Name: peroxisomal trans-2-enoyl-CoA reductase
